Hi all, today we have released the Z-Push 2.0.5RC version (build 1511). Notes It fixes the IOS6 meeting "hijacking" issue (read more at http://www.zarafa.com/blog/post/2012/10/ios6-meeting-hijacking-fixed-open-source-activesync-implementation-z-push). It also fixes that "out-of-sync-window" appointments are deleted in Zarafa when using HTC devices. Droid 3 is now able to get the full message and Nokia N9MeeGo is able to download attachments. Fileas default order for contacts created or edited on the mobile is now "Lastname, Firstname" (this setting is for displaying in outlook/webaccess only, mobile devices show contacts depending on the setting on a device).
